Like 46 million Americans (according to the National Alliance on Mental Illness), I regularly deal with a mental disorder that has the possible to interrupt my life. Some days it comes in the type of an emotional breakdown that stops everything I'm doing dead in its tracks. The majority of the time, however, it is quieter.
Unlike numerous physical health problems or disabilities, having a mental disorder isn't always visible to the people you deal with. This can be a double-edged sword. On the one hand, it implies you might not deal with as Mental Health Facility much open discrimination as someone with a more visible condition. On the other hand, when your mental disorder makes doing your work tough, to outsiders it can look as if you're simply not doing your task well, which likewise makes it difficult to get the support you need.
Here, we'll discuss a few of the assistance you can anticipate from your company, but we'll likewise talk about methods you can use to make it through the day, even when you're not feeling your best. Firstly, in many cases, you have the right under the Americans With Disabilities Act not to reveal that you experience any psychological illness, so long as it does not impact your ability to do your job.
you may require to reveal your condition. One of your main protections under the A.D.A. is that your employer can not victimize you since of your condition. While companies have the right not to employ anyone they think can not carry out the duties a task needs, they are not enabled to use the truth that you have a mental disorder alone as a reason to discipline or terminate you.

For example, if you suffer from anxiety, and your company doing not have an appropriate understanding of anxiety's signs incorrectly believes you would be too glum or unfortunate to take care of customers, she or he would not have the ability to fire you or utilize it as a factor to keep a promotion.
If you got repeated complaints from clients about bad service or regularly failed to show up to work, however, your employer could utilize this as a factor for discipline or termination. The Equal Job Opportunity Commission is the federal government company charged with implementing the A.D.A. and, according to the commission's website, you have a right under the A.D.A.
Those accommodations consist of however may not be restricted to: If you need time off for therapy appointments or to look after affordable treatment, an employer should make an affordable effort to work around your schedule. That does not suggest giving you as many day of rests as you desire, but rather things like adjusting shifts around your consultations or offering ill days when your condition is worse.
State you have a sensory concern that makes it tough to maintain verbal guidelines: You can request that your company send guidelines in writing instead.
